These last two months we have seen the fruit of the discipleship classes our Men, Women, and Youth have been receiving at the church as they are spending more time in the Word. In May we had a Women’s Conference based on the book “The Lies Women believe and the Truth that sets them free!” What a beautiful time it was! Jim and Linda Mather were there behind the scenes helping Estie, Haniel, and Sarai getting all the prep-work done for the conference. Estie and Linda did a beautiful job decorating the church. Haniel and Sarai did a beautiful job preparing a book for each person…80 in all! Haniel is a graphic designer and did a great job designing the cover and formatting the book for printing. Sarai translated the book so each woman could walk away with the key “Truth” verses to battle the lies! Four of us in leadership gave conferences touching on each chapter of the book. Our closing message was on “Lies we believe about our emotions and circumstances” and a challenge was given for the body to let go of those obstacles that were holding them back from walking in freedom. An altar call was made for those that wanted healing from emotional and physical problems. Can you believe everybody came forward! It was probably the most awesome worship service we have had this year. It was very special and we saw the body grow from God’s touch on their lives! The youth did an awesome job serving these ladies during the whole weekend. This was the fruit of them being touched at their Youth retreat the previous month! It is so beautiful to see the body ministering one to another. We are really, really being blessed!

Then going into summer we will be finishing up our school year at CCMS. We will have graduation where we will recognize the children for their “faithfulness” to stick out the entire year by awarding them a school supply voucher for next school year and a diploma. We will invite the parents to have the opportunity to share with them all that God has done in their children’s in hope that they will receive Christ as well. They will also be rewarding a food staple packet.
